Output 6f4c28d62c161dcca0e7829d70f867dba15f2e17059d4a0ea4d13f9af1334eb4:51

value
40967906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b53b424891ec8cabe9bd680674b304083d56e99c OP_EQUAL
address
MQRRXXthYESBvFN7sFi64WZdNXGpVe5T3k
transaction
6f4c28d62c161dcca0e7829d70f867dba15f2e17059d4a0ea4d13f9af1334eb4
spent
true